The Bitter Truth

In the whirlwind of our fast-paced lives, sugar has become a convenient staple. Statistics reveal that the average American consumes about 152 pounds of sugar per year, a staggering amount that translates into approximately 22 teaspoons daily. This excessive consumption is often linked to a slew of health issues, including obesity, diabetes, and heart disease. But what exactly does sugar do to our bodies? Let’s dive into the depths of this sweet enigma.

How Sugar Affects Your Body

  • Quick Energy Burst: Sugar is a quick source of energy, leading to the infamous sugar rush. Glucose enters your bloodstream rapidly, giving you that instant burst of vitality.
  • Insulin Resistance: Over time, excessive sugar floods our system, prompting our pancreas to produce more insulin. This can lead to insulin resistance, a precursor to type 2 diabetes.
  • Weight Gain: Each spoonful of sugar contains a hefty 16 calories and no nutritional value, making it easy to exceed daily caloric limits without realizing it.
  • Mood Swings: The rollercoaster ride of blood sugar levels can affect your mood, leading to irritability and fatigue.
  • Dental Decay: Sugar is a playground for harmful bacteria in your mouth, leading to cavities and gum disease.

Hidden Health Benefits

While the negatives may seem overwhelming, there are ways to enjoy sugar in moderation that can lead to surprising health benefits. Here are some practical tips to navigate the sugary minefield:

  1. Choose Natural Sources: Opt for fruits and vegetables that provide natural sugars along with fiber, vitamins, and minerals. For instance, an apple has about 19 grams of natural sugar but also packs 4 grams of fiber.
  2. Cook at Home: When you prepare meals, you can better control the amount of sugar that goes into your dishes, opting for honey or maple syrup as natural sweeteners.
  3. Stay Hydrated: Sometimes, thirst can be mistaken for hunger. Drinking water can help regulate your sugar cravings.
  4. Mindful Eating: Savor your treats! Take time to enjoy desserts and pay attention to portion sizes. Your taste buds will thank you.
  5. Read Labels: Familiarize yourself with ingredient lists and nutrition facts. Watch for hidden sugars in items like sauces, bread, and even dressings.
